What does it feel like to be guided by an inner compass? How can you give back and benefit within your community? What is toxic masculinity and is it worse for an African American man?
In this episode of The Kathie J Show, I asked my friend, DJ KTone, and his mother, Hanifah, to talk about their life from Jersey to Denver. Hanifah is fascinating to learn from, and I could talk to her all day. DJ KTone is nothing but honest about being a positive masculine male, son, uncle, father and friend. His foundation KTone Cares Foundation is focused on giving back and fighting mental illnesses. He is currently accepting applications for his college scholarships.
